Those are the first generation Falcons with the T300 weave. The new ones with the T700 have a different C4 logo sticker on them.
-
I've never heard of those specifications, sounds like manufacturer mumbo jumbo to me. The carbon fiber fabric I know is specified in #K and #g/m² twill or plain.
-
those are the terms for describing the weight of the fabric and the weave. the T400 and T700 are to the best of my knowledge the terms C4 uses. I dont know what the actual difference is and the pattern (weave) looks almost identical.
